Colleagues rally around couple during health crisis

Dr. Emily Isaacson and Dr. William Bradley at the Honors House.

Last summer, Dr. William Bradley had just been hired for a one-year appointment as the coordinator of the Writing Center. Although he knew there was a lot of work ahead to publicize and promote the center as an excellent resource for 'Berg students, he was thrilled about the opportunity. Things were going well – until cancer threw him a major curve ball. Faculty colleagues rallied to support William and his wife, Dr. Emily Isaacson, offering assistance that helped them through a dark and difficult time.

Earlier this month, William's essay about his experiences with his illness and how it changed his perspective on teaching was published in Inside Higher Education.
